10 Enchanting Fall Perfumes: Embrace the Scents of Musk and Havana Tobacco
Discovering the Perfect Fall Fragrance
Choosing a fragrance for fall is much simpler than selecting one for the hot summer months. The range of ingredients ideal for the season is much broader, and contemporary trends offer a wide array of exquisite brand scents from which you can find something perfectly suited to you. In the fall of 2016, the most diverse flowers, creamy and spicy notes, a hint of sweet vanilla, and even tobacco take center stage. We have curated several excellent perfumes with lasting scents and distinct individuality.
Tom Ford: A Floral Whirlwind
The magnificent scent from Tom Ford is a whirlwind of floral shades combined with creamy notes. Petals of tuberose, black orchid, patchouli in combination with vanilla and chestnut create a unique trail and evoke the feeling of a romantic stroll through an autumn garden.
Tom Ford – Orchid Soleil, $82
DKNY: A Touch of Summer
A hint of summer lingers in the incredibly appetizing aroma from Donna Karan. Ingredients used in this perfume include black currant, licorice, apple, wine, and a combination of violet and patchouli flowers. This scent is perfect for those who prefer sweet and cloying aromas, with the typical DKNY character. A slightly mystical and coquettish scent, reminiscent of a caramel apple, popular among Halloween desserts.
DKNY – Be Tempted, $70
Dior: Floral Elegance
Dior’s fragrances are unmistakable, thanks to the characteristic floral shimmers of the fashion house’s scents, which can add color even to the gloomiest atmosphere. A great choice for the fall season if you want to bloom when even nature around you is wilting. The combination of peonies, roses, and red berries creates a romantic aroma for any weather.
Dior – Absolutely Blooming, $124
Elizabeth & James: Spicy Sensuality
For fans of pronounced sensuality, the spicy and heady aroma from Elizabeth and James, combining woody notes with the scent of vanilla, the persistence of bourbon, and tuberose flowers, is ideal. Musk lingers on the skin for a long time, creating a scent of poetic sensuality, reminiscent of Baudelaire. In other words, this is a perfume that combines elegance and danger.
Elizabeth and James – Nirvana Bourbon, $65
Chloé: Citrus Freshness
If you find it hard to resist citrus notes, then the fragrance from Chloé is what you need. The fall perfume from the fashion house combines the most sour-sweet ingredients, such as lemon, verbena, amber, and cedar. This perfume creates a gentle, barely perceptible fresh trail with a persistent sour taste. A feminine and playful aroma for the new season.
Chloé – Fleur de Parfum, $105
Chanel: Citrus Confidence
Not only Chloé can delight fans of citrus aromas. Chanel presents a fragrance infused with confidence and more mature femininity. Lemon and orange combined with rose and jasmine flowers create the feeling of a gentle flower field, while musk and cotton make the scent deeper and more persistent. Classic elegance and a touch of luxury are the distinctive features of Chanel’s fragrances.
Chanel – No.5 L’Eau, $132
YSL: Irresistible Allure
The seductive and strong perfume from Yves Saint Laurent is a scent that is impossible to resist. The mystical and dark aroma is created by the combination of coffee, vanilla, fir, and a mix of flowers. Excitement, pleasure, and satisfaction—opium for discerning perfume enthusiasts.
Yves Saint Laurent – Black Opium, $68
TokyoMilk: Fatal Attraction
Another fatal scent from TokyoMilk is perfect for those who cannot be satisfied with a floral aroma but prefer something more fatal. Ginger, pepper, frankincense, and vanilla orchid create a real explosion of spice. An exotic and persistent aroma, showing strength, danger, and destructive sensuality.
TokyoMilk – Dark Femme Fatale Collection – Novacaine No.85, $42
Prada: Ocean Breeze
For those who want to reminisce about summer, the scent of the ocean, memories of sandy dunes, and the freshness of the sea breeze, the fragrance from Prada is perfect. The exotic flowers of plumeria and ylang-ylang, combined with vanilla and vetiver, create one of the freshest and lightest scents of the fall.
Prada – La Femme, $95
Kenzo: Spirit of Rebellion
A sense of novelty and rebellion is felt in the new fragrance from Kenzo. The combination of peonies, Egyptian jasmine, and ambroxan creates a truly light but persistent scent, with brightly expressed red berries and the characteristic sharp notes of the brand’s fragrances. The packaging design, inspired by the blue of the ocean, is an attempt to achieve uniqueness and self-awareness through perfume.
